In the previous couple of years, the prices and impacts of local weather change have change into unavoidably clear to Australians. In the summertime of 2019-2020, the nation noticed considered one of its worst bushfire seasons and in 2021-2022 devastating flooding stuffed headlines. In an editorial endorsing the Labor Get together’s bid for presidency earlier this 12 months, The Age wrote that “a change of presidency is required to start restoring integrity to federal politics and … resist the problem of local weather change.”
Positive sufficient, Australia’s federal election in Could 2022 noticed the incumbent Liberal/Nationwide Coalition – then led by Prime Minister Scott Morrison – fail to safe a fourth consecutive time period. As an alternative, for the primary time since 2007 the Labor Get together, led by Anthony Albanese, achieved a majority authorities. Throughout Australia, voters swung away from the Liberal Get together’s coalition, switching their votes to Labor or “teal independents” for whom local weather change is a important problem.
Months later, the Labor authorities has maneuvered Australia towards changing into a extra accountable world energy in relation to local weather change. The highway forward isn’t simple, notably given Australia’s important coal business. However, as Dr. Robert Glasser explains within the interview beneath, Labor has positioned itself nicely politically to pursue an formidable local weather agenda.

What affect did the difficulty of local weather change have within the Australian Federal election in Could?
Local weather change had an unlimited affect within the Australian Federal election. Certainly, it was referred to as the “local weather election” by many. Labor campaigned on a platform of extra formidable local weather motion, and it was a significant factor within the swing in opposition to Scott Morrison’s conservative coalition.
The modifications in rhetoric and motion on local weather change since Labor’s election victory have been hanging. The federal government has enshrined a extra formidable local weather goal – decreasing greenhouse gases by 43 % by 2030 – in laws. It has produced the nation’s first local weather and safety threat evaluation and initiated a course of throughout authorities to develop a serious technique to strengthen nationwide resilience to local weather impacts.
